Does anyone know if there are lowering kits available for this bike? A friend of mine told me he has seen them, but no service shops around here say they're available. I'm looking to get about an inch off the height in some way or another. If not, are there thinner seat pads or anything I can get somewhere?

dgyver

Someone was making them here at one time, not sure if they still are. Other bikes will fit. Stock length is 7-1/16".

http://www.venhorstrocks.com/SUZUKI_GS500F_PARTS.html

A couple of thing to consider...the side stand will be too long but can be shortened and you may have a hard time using the center stand.

I got more than an inch off of my 500F with a cut seat.  Make sure someone good does it; whoever the dealer outsourced it to did a crappy job, and I had Rich (of Rich's Custom Seats) fix it.  Rich charges about $150 to others' ~$100, but the seat fits my butt perfectly and my feet are now firmly on the balls rather than tilted on one tippytoe; well worth the money.  I like to do what I can with the seat and leave the suspension intact if I can.
